Walkthrough: Changing Your Birth Date on Facebook

Adjusting settings via desktop and mobile only requires a few quick clicks. Just take care to double check accuracy!

Desktop Instructions

  1. Login to Facebook on your Mac, PC or Linux computer.
  2. Click the dropdown arrow in the top right corner.
  3. From the menu select "Settings".
  4. On the left sidebar click “Personal Information”.
  5. Beside Birthday, click “Edit”.
  6. Pick a new date from the dropdown menus.
  7. Triple check the date looks correct!
  8. Click “Review Change” then “Save Changes” to confirm the edit.

Mobile Instructions

Fetch your device and let‘s continue.

  1. Launch the Facebook app from your homescreen.
  2. Tap the “More” icon (3 horizontal lines).
  3. Scroll down and select “Settings & Privacy”.
  4. Tap "Settings".
  5. Tap "Personal Information".
  6. Tap "Birthdate".
  7. Tap the Edit icon.
  8. Spin the date wheels and set your new date.
  9. Verify the change looks accurate.
  10. Tap “Save” to solidify the change.

Pro Tip: Restrict Birth Date Visibility

Now that you have a new secret date, why not limit visibility? By default all friends see your birthday.

Reduce sharing with a couple quick privacy tweaks:

  1. From desktop or mobile follow steps 1-5 above to access birthday settings.
  2. Underneath the set date, tap or click the audience selector beside “Birthday Privacy”.
  3. Choose an option: Public, Friends, Only Me, or Custom to fine tune access.
  4. Don‘t forget to update both month/day AND year visibility.
  5. Click Save Changes.
